Transaction 65391ca496e391596eb97ac89c53b442b5d668af191e1a8ee8d8d84270ff3956
1 Input
1 Output
-
65391ca496e391596eb97ac89c53b442b5d668af191e1a8ee8d8d84270ff3956:0
- value
- 125953
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20bf53b9b2780f5bd4d324ac3356a969f5a21f48 OP_EQUAL
- address
- 34gAkKTGr6nPutBdn6agqWCxLcm7U2aNGK